The <<() is an inbuilt function in Ruby inserts the element in the SizedQueue. The SizedQueue have a particular capacity and cannot accept elements once it is full.
Syntax: sq_name << element
Parameters: The function takes the element to be inserted into the SizedQueue.
Return Value: It inserts the element into the SizedQueue.
